MOSES LAKE – Big Bend Community College faculty recognized their top students from the 2018-19 academic year during a ceremony at Wallenstein Theater on May 1. 

Thirty-four students from various disciplines were awarded the Outstanding Student designation this year.

Top student-athletes and campus club officers were also recognized during the ceremony. 

Students selected Math instructor Tyler Wallace for outstanding full-time faculty member of the year and Director of Residence Halls and Residence Life Luis Alvarez as outstanding part-time faculty member of the year.
